当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

oss对象存储原理,对象存储技术原理与实战应用,深度解析阿里云OSS的优缺点及行业实践

oss对象存储原理,对象存储技术原理与实战应用,深度解析阿里云OSS的优缺点及行业实践

对象存储作为云时代核心存储方案,采用分布式架构实现海量数据高可用存储,其核心原理包括数据分片、元数据管理及分布式容灾机制,支持PB级非结构化数据存储与秒级访问,阿里云O...

对象存储作为云时代核心存储方案,采用分布式架构实现海量数据高可用存储,其核心原理包括数据分片、元数据管理及分布式容灾机制,支持PB级非结构化数据存储与秒级访问,阿里云OSS作为典型对象存储服务,具备多区域容灾、高并发访问(单账号百万级QPS)、按需付费的低成本优势,通过API和SDK无缝对接业务系统,广泛应用于互联网企业静态资源托管、媒体内容分发及金融日志存储场景,其不足在于跨区域迁移成本较高,依赖阿里云生态,且监控体系需结合云厂商工具完善,行业实践中,某电商平台利用OSS实现日均10亿级图片存储,通过生命周期策略降低存储成本35%;政务部门借助其版本控制功能保障数据合规审计,验证了对象存储在多元场景下的技术适配性与商业价值。

(全文约2580字)

引言:云存储演进与对象存储的崛起 在数字化转型加速的背景下,全球数据量正以年均26%的速度增长(IDC 2023报告),传统文件存储系统已难以满足海量数据、高并发访问和全球部署的需求,对象存储作为云原生存储架构的代表,凭借其分布式架构和弹性扩展能力,正在重构企业数据存储范式,阿里云OSS(Object Storage Service)作为国内领先的云存储服务,已支撑超过百万企业用户,存储数据量突破1.2万亿GB,本文将从技术原理出发,结合架构设计、应用场景和实际案例,系统解析对象存储的核心优势与潜在挑战。

oss对象存储原理,对象存储技术原理与实战应用,深度解析阿里云OSS的优缺点及行业实践

图片来源于网络,如有侵权联系删除

对象存储技术原理深度解构 2.1 分布式存储架构设计 对象存储采用"中心节点+数据节点"的树状架构(图1),通过MD5/SHA1算法实现全球唯一标识符(Key),每个对象包含元数据(Metadata)和内容(Body),阿里云OSS采用"3副本+跨可用区分布"策略,在物理层面实现数据冗余,在逻辑层面通过分片(Sharding)技术将对象拆分为128KB的片段(可配置1-16MB),经哈希算法分配至不同数据节点。

2 高性能访问机制 基于HTTP/1.1协议的对象存储系统,通过以下技术实现高吞吐:

  • 分片并行访问:单次请求可同时操作多个分片
  • 缓存加速:TTL缓存策略(默认72小时)配合Redis缓存集群
  • CDN边缘节点:全球30+节点实现200ms级访问延迟
  • 带宽聚合:多CDN线路智能切换(HTTP/HTTPS/QUIC)

3 数据生命周期管理 oss命令行工具支持完整的数据管理链路:

  • 版本控制:自动保留最多1000个版本(默认10个)
  • 生命周期策略:自动转存至归档存储(OSS Archive)
  • 冷热分层:标准型(6副本)与归档型(1副本)混合部署
  • 定期备份:每日全量备份+增量备份(RPO=秒级)

核心优势剖析 3.1 弹性扩展能力 某跨境电商案例显示,通过对象存储的"按需付费"模式,其存储容量在黑五期间从200TB扩展至1200TB,成本仅增加37%,具体实现:

  • 存储单元自动扩容(最小10GB)
  • 带宽突发计费(0.5元/GB/月)
  • 跨地域同步(香港+新加坡+北美三节点)

2 全球分发网络 阿里云CDN全球节点覆盖(图2),某视频平台通过"对象存储+CDN"组合,将东南亚地区访问延迟从800ms降至120ms,关键技术:

  • 分片级缓存(对象分片缓存命中率92%)
  • 智能路由算法(基于BGP与地理信息)版本控制(支持多版本CDN同步)

3 高安全性保障 对象存储提供五层安全防护体系:

  1. 密钥管理:RAM用户独立密钥(支持KMS硬件加密)
  2. 访问控制:COS桶策略(支持IAM权限体系)
  3. 数据加密:对象上传自动加密(AES-256)
  4. 审计日志:操作日志保留180天(可导出为CSV)
  5. 防DDoS:基于IP/Key的访问限流(QPS可调)

关键挑战与应对策略 4.1 高并发场景性能瓶颈 某直播平台在百万级并发场景下遇到响应延迟问题,通过以下优化:

  • 分片大小调整:将默认128KB调整为256KB(吞吐提升40%)
  • 分片数量限制:单对象分片数从16提升至32
  • 带宽配额优化:申请突发带宽配额(3000Mbps)
  • 多区域部署:主备节点分离(香港+北京双活)

2 跨区域同步复杂性 某跨国企业面临数据合规问题,采用混合架构:

  • 核心数据:香港+新加坡双可用区(RTO<15分钟)
  • 历史数据:OSS Archive归档至美国
  • 同步策略:异步复制(延迟<5分钟)
  • 成本优化:归档存储节省68%成本

3 冷热数据管理难题 某视频网站实施分层存储方案:

  • 热数据:标准型存储(5元/GB/月)
  • 温数据:低频访问对象转存至归档存储(0.5元/GB/月)
  • 冷数据:归档存储+磁带冷备(年成本0.2元/GB)
  • 查询优化:OSS Search功能(10元/次)

典型行业应用实践 5.1 电商大促场景 某头部电商在双十一期间部署:

  • 流量预测:基于历史数据的弹性扩容(准确率92%)
  • 防雪崩设计:设置10%的突发带宽预留
  • 容灾方案:主站(OSS)+灾备站(OSS异地)
  • 成本控制:流量包节省45%

2 媒体内容分发 某视频平台构建全球分发网络:

oss对象存储原理,对象存储技术原理与实战应用,深度解析阿里云OSS的优缺点及行业实践

图片来源于网络,如有侵权联系删除

  • 对象存储+CDN混合架构
  • 分片缓存策略(对象生命周期管理)
  • 动态DNS解析(支持百万级域名)
  • 容灾演练:72小时RTO恢复验证

3 金融数据合规 某银行采用混合存储方案:

  • 核心交易数据:标准型存储(3副本)
  • 监管日志:归档存储+本地备份
  • 合规审计:操作日志留存180天
  • 加密策略:传输加密+存储加密双重保障

未来技术演进方向 6.1 与边缘计算的融合 阿里云OSS正在构建边缘存储网络:

  • 边缘节点部署在5G基站(延迟<50ms)
  • 本地缓存策略(LRU-K算法)
  • 边缘计算协同(Flink实时处理)

2 绿色存储技术 2024年推出的"冷热循环存储"方案:

  • 存储介质智能切换(SSD/HDD/磁带)
  • 能耗优化算法(温度感应+负载均衡)
  • 碳排放计算工具(支持TCO分析)

3 全球合规数据管理 正在构建的多区域存储体系:

  • 欧盟GDPR合规存储
  • 中国数据本地化要求
  • 美国CLOUD法案适配
  • 跨境数据流动监控

实施建议与最佳实践 7.1 成本优化策略

  • 分片大小优化:根据访问频率调整(热数据256KB,冷数据4MB)
  • 存储类型选择:突发流量使用流量包,持续流量使用按量付费
  • 多协议混合部署:HTTP/2 + gRPC协议组合

2 安全加固方案

  • 密钥轮换机制(季度自动更新)
  • 威胁情报集成(基于阿里云安全大脑)
  • 增强审计日志(支持API级别追踪)

3 性能调优指南

  • 带宽配额优化:申请突发带宽(建议值=日常峰值×1.5)
  • 缓存策略调整:热对象缓存时间延长至7天
  • 分片数量控制:不超过32片(超过需申请特批)

结论与展望 对象存储作为云原生时代的核心基础设施,正在重塑企业数据管理范式,阿里云OSS通过持续技术创新,在性能、安全、成本等方面取得显著突破,但企业仍需根据自身业务特点进行架构设计,随着边缘计算、AI大模型和元宇宙技术的演进,对象存储将向"智能存储"、"低碳存储"和"全球协同"方向持续进化,成为数字经济的核心支撑底座。

(注:本文数据来源于阿里云技术白皮书、行业报告及公开案例,技术细节已做脱敏处理)

黑狐家游戏

发表评论

最新文章